Dan Bilefsky
Dan Bilefsky is a Montreal-based journalist who spent two decades as a foreign correspondent for the New York Times, reporting from dozens of countries. He was previously a staff writer for the Financial Times and the Wall Street Journal. He was part of a Times team that won a George Polk Award and was a Pulitzer Prize finalist for its investigation into the Haitian president’s assassination. He is the author of The Last Job, a true-crime thriller about a gang of geriatric thieves.
